## Local Setup

Portionwise is the recipe-scaling calculator behind the Cinderplate app. To run it locally, install Ruby 3.2, run `bundle install`, then `bin/setup` to create and seed the development database with sample recipes and unit conversion tables. The test suite expects the seeded conversions, so don't skip that step. Start the server with `bin/dev`. The setup script provisions the schema against the following.

primary connection of yagep-kahip = redis://giliel_svc:zYiKsLL2PLpfPL@db-348f.xolmarsys.corp:5432/fenwyn

Snapshot testing, Bramleaf UI kit. Plugin authors: run `bramleaf snap` before submitting. Failing snapshots mean your component markup drifted from baseline. Review diffs, don't blindly update. Theming changes require a fresh baseline approved by a core maintainer. Flaky snapshots usually mean unstubbed timers or random IDs — fix those first. Include the build token from your passing run below.

session token of fahap-hawip = htk31_7852f2b3276dba2738f98fa97f92237

MEMO — Kettling Depot Receiving

Uniform sets for the new Kettling depot arrive Wednesday via Ashgrove courier: 40 boxes, sorted by size, manifest attached to box one. Check the count at the dock before signing; shortages go straight to stores, not the courier. The hand-over instruction the courier will follow is set out below.

drop instructions, tafof-baguf: the holmir gilox courier leaves the sormir ulaok holdor ledger at gate 5596 under passcode 257343

Handover note — Crumbwheel order cutoffs.

Welcome aboard. The bakery cutoff rule in Crumbwheel closes same-day orders at 14:00 local to each storefront, not UTC — this has bitten us twice. Holiday overrides live in the calendar service and take precedence silently, so always check there first when a cutoff looks wrong. To unlock the calendar service's admin console after a restart, enter the recovery passphrase below.

vault phrase of bagap-bahaf = silion-pelox-sorox-casdor-quenwyn-fraax-eliox-praael-kelion-quenvan-kasox-rusael-norius-belvan